Output a0a688323d4101a7852f01e18709f8a924e00e3c4655bd8118fe6c50f1a25883:18

value
15879551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f7ce9b4d071ea0f723269111ec59b4bf006a1a OP_EQUAL
address
MUbFoiiVfxbfdAPCbwNVDUro77VWTTMZqW
transaction
a0a688323d4101a7852f01e18709f8a924e00e3c4655bd8118fe6c50f1a25883
spent
true